I'm finding middling to good - there has been shining beacons such as the powerhouse performances from Lin Blakley and Roger Sloan as their portrayal of grieving grandparents Pam and Les with Paul's death. Linda Marlowe's underrated performance as dementia sufferer Sylvie and of course Jamie Borthwick's strong delivery with Jay's downward spiral. There is room for improvement - ie the Shakil and Bex drama-rama, Babe getting away with it again and the Carter's forgiving her, plus the other crap such as the Salsa school and don't get me started about how dire June was.
